Viktor Petrovich Serebryanikov also spelled Serebryannikov, was a Soviet association football player from Ukraine. Serebrianikov was a member of the Dynamo's squad that for the first time won the Soviet championship title in 1961 becoming the first non-Moscow team to achieve that feat, so called "the first height".
